THE STORY BOOK I LIKE BEST
THE
STORY BOOK I LIKE BEST
During
one of the recent holidays my sister gave me the simplified version of the
“Table of Two Cities” written by Charles Dickens to read. After reading a few
pages, I began to feel interested in the story because almost the whole story was
thrilling.
I
must admit, that when I read it first, I could not understand some parts of the
story and so I read for a second time.
Dr.
Manette, his daughter and French peasants still haunt my imagination. Of all
the characters in the novel, I am full of praise for Sidney Carton. He should
be called the hero of the story, because this selfless man volunteered to
sacrifice his life for the sake of Lucy Manette whom he loved once.
I
like this story so much that if I get a second chance I will read it again. I
also would like to recommend this book to my fellow students. Indeed it is a
book which teaches us something about humanity in all forms.
